How they compare
Latvia currently reports 1.75 m3 per person against 0.0159 m3 per person in World, a difference of 1.73 m3 per person.
That makes Latvia's figure about 110.3 times World's.
Across all 33 years both countries report, Latvia has been ahead every year.
Latvia ranks 1st and World ranks 1st of 183 countries.
Latvia has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Latvia | World |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 0.5973 m3 per person | 0.0164 m3 per person | 0.5808 m3 per person | Latvia |
| 2000s | 1.14 m3 per person | 0.019 m3 per person | 1.12 m3 per person | Latvia |
| 2010s | 1.43 m3 per person | 0.0184 m3 per person | 1.41 m3 per person | Latvia |
| 2020s | 1.8 m3 per person | 0.0179 m3 per person | 1.78 m3 per person | Latvia |
Averages of every year both report within each decade.
